This tour grants you general admission. That means your ferry boat transportation is included and you have access to both islands including the Statue of Liberty Museum and the Ellis Island National Museum of Immigration. This does not grant you access inside the statue or pedestal.
The National Parks Service, which oversees the properties, does not sell group tickets for entry to the Statue of Liberty.
If you want to enter the Statue of Liberty when you travel with Martz, you may purchase tickets online for either pedestal access or crown access. These tickets are limited and reservations are required. Therefore, you should order your tickets at this website as soon as possible since both crown and pedestal access tickets are very limited.

All passengers boarding the ferry must undergo airport-style security screening. Large bags, markers, sharp objects, and weapons are not allowed on the ferry.
IMPORTANT TICKET INFORMATION:
Crown access tickets for the Statue of Liberty are limited and must be purchased in advance. Children ages 4 and younger are not permitted crown access.
Pedestal access tickets are limited, and reservations are required. Pedestal tickets allow visitors access to the top of the pedestal, which includes lower pedestal levels.

The ferry is accessible for wheelchairs. There are a few steps for passengers who choose to go up to the deck.
Crown access allows visitors to access the crown, which includes a walk up 162 steps from the feet of the statue to the crown. There is no elevator access to the crown.
